Output 74d4fa800350509f53a4d42a7dd7750bf3e550ad58d0a7da1b78fea4f6094e21:1

value
14361584
script pubkey
OP_0 OP_PUSHBYTES_20 3ebea463cb5cef8f3dd2f1cfa4cd8bde4d12b1d1
address
bc1q86l2gc7ttnhc70wj7886fnvtmex39vw3v073fj
transaction
74d4fa800350509f53a4d42a7dd7750bf3e550ad58d0a7da1b78fea4f6094e21
spent
true